ZIP Code 14859 – United States

ZIP Code 14859 belongs to Lockwood, NY. The table below show the information about the city, county, state, latitude, longitude of ZIP code 14859.

ZIP Code14859
PlaceLockwood
CountyTioga
StateNew York
Latitude42.1149
Longitude-76.5366
